How to Play Call of Duty: Black Ops 7 on Xbox Game Pass from Day One? Check Modes, System Requirements, More

Fans of the iconic shooter franchise are in for a treat: Call of Duty: Black Ops 7 arrives on the subscription service Xbox Game Pass on November 14, 2025, and will be playable across cloud, console and PC from day one for eligible subscribers. Developed by Treyarch in collaboration with Raven Software, this latest edition continues the gripping Black Ops storyline and offers a full package of campaign, multiplayer and Zombies modes.

Accessing Black Ops 7 via Game Pass

If you're eager to get in on day one, here are the key things to know:

  • The game is confirmed to be included in Game Pass from day one - meaning on release day, subscribers to the correct tier will have access.
  • To play on console or PC, you'll need either Game Pass Ultimate (which covers console, PC and cloud) or PC Game Pass for PC. Note: Standard console-only tiers may not give you access to this launch day title.
  • For Game Pass users on Xbox console, go to the Game Pass library on or after November 14 and search for Black Ops 7. It will be marked as "Included with Game Pass".
  • Pre-install or pre-load the game where possible: On PC, pre-loading begins on November 10 at 9 AM PT (~10:30 PM IST) to ensure you're ready at launch.
  • On console or cloud, check for the "Install" or "Add to my library" prompt ahead of time, so you're ready to dive in when the game unlocks.

By making sure your subscription tier is correct, your console or PC is ready, and you've pre-downloaded the game, you'll eliminate launch-day delays and be prepared for the full experience.

System Requirements (PC and Handheld)

While Xbox consoles are covered under Game Pass with minimal fuss, PC players and handheld users should check the hardware requirements closely.

According to official info:

Minimum (PC): Windows 10 (64-bit), AMD Ryzen 5 1400 or Intel Core i5-6600, 8 GB RAM, GPU such as AMD Radeon RX 470 or NVIDIA GeForce GTX 970/1060 with ~3 GB video memory. SSD with 116 GB available. TPM 2.0 + Secure Boot required.

Recommended / High Settings: Windows 11 (64-bit) is strongly suggested, with CPUs like AMD Ryzen 5 1600X or Intel Core i7-6700K, 12 GB RAM, GPU like AMD Radeon RX 6600 XT or N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3060 with ~8 GB video memory.

Competitive / Ultra 4K Settings: For ultra-4K or competitive framerates: Windows 11, AMD Ryzen 5 5600X or Intel Core i7-10700K, 16 GB RAM, GPU like AMD Radeon RX 9070 XT or N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4080 / 5070 with ~16 GB video memory.

Handheld / Windows-based small device support: The game is optimised for Windows-based handhelds such as the "ROG Xbox Ally" or "ROG Xbox Ally X". UI and performance have been tuned for smaller screens, native controller support and smooth framerate.

For console players (Xbox Series X|S and Xbox One), ensure you have enough free storage space and a stable internet connection if playing via cloud or Game Pass.

In short, if you're on a recent console, you're covered. If you're playing on PC or a handheld, check your specs in advance to ensure smooth play.

Game Modes, Features & What to Expect

What's inside Black Ops 7 at launch? The game features multiple modes catering to different types of players:

Co-op Campaign: The campaign supports solo or squad play, taking you across near-future environments (e.g., Japan rooftops, Mediterranean scenes) on a high-stakes mission.

Multiplayer: Launch will include 16 multiplayer maps plus larger-scale action (two 20v20 maps) featuring 6v6 classic modes and larger skirmishes. Additional movement mechanics (e.g., "Omnimovement" system) and advanced customisation options are included.

Zombies Mode: The round-based Zombies mode returns with a new narrative set in the "Dark Aether" universe, continuing the tradition of cooperative undead mayhem.

These options mean whether you prefer solo story, team multiplayer or co-op zombie survival, there's something for you.

Final Checklist Before Launch

  1. Confirm your Game Pass subscription includes Ultimate or PC tier.
  2. Update your console/PC and install the Game Pass app ahead of launch.
  3. Pre-load/download the game ahead of November 14 to save wait time.
  4. On PC: ensure you meet at least minimum specs, and update your GPU drivers.
  5. On handheld or cloud: make sure your device supports the resolution, controller setup and required inputs.
  6. Once live, dive into the campaign, jump into multiplayer, or co-op Zombies mode and enjoy day one access.
